Ha Joon Chang teaches economics at Cambridge University, and writes a column for the Guardian. The Observer called his book 23 Things They Don't Tell You About Capitalism, which was a no. 1 bestseller, 'a witty and timely debunking of some of the biggest myths surrounding the global economy.'
